The main advantage of the PLEX media server is multiplatform, because it supports work on smartphones, tablets and PCs running OS X, Windows, Linux, smart TVs and NAS.
Like any high-quality software media server PLEX MEDIA Server easily streams any media content and provides them with additional information from the Internet (complements movies with posters, descriptions and information about the genre, director, and music covers and info info). The most interesting thing is that only a web browser and active Internet connection is sufficient for remote playback of its own media file collection. Enter the Plex.tv browser in the address bar and log in to your account to gain access to your entire media library. Plus, you will be available for downloading films for offline viewing.
To turn your PC into a home media server, it is enough to install the PLEX Media server program. After installing Plex, your web browser will automatically start. Register, and then make a step-by-step setting process using a web interface. Give your understandable name to your Plex server and specify your collection with movies, music and photos so that Plex Media Server can scan your folders with a media content to streamline and download additional information from the Internet.
After this procedure in the PLEX web interface, your musical collections with covers will be available to you, films with posters and photos with prevni. In this way, you can get more information about any file or instantly start playing it. In addition to local media files, you can add to the library and online services using the "Channels" menu. On the LG 2011-2013 TVs with the Netcast Operations, the Plex Client application is already in stock. Called "media". If you are on the same network with PLEX Media Server, then when you start the application on a TV, it will find the server with automatt and offered viewing content from it.
If we talk about LG TVs on a WebOS, then the Plex application needs to be installed from the application store. After installing and starting Plex, it will ask for authorization through the input of the 4th digit code. After that, you can watch Content with Plex Media Server.
There is one very significant difference between the client on Netcast and Webos - location on the Plex server network. In the case of the WebOS, the server can be anywhere, i.e. Not in one local network. In the case of Netcast - only on the local network. For this, there is an alternative PLEX client - Playz. True in Playz there is no authorization as in Plex for Webos, but after the PlexMediaServer configuration you can get Playz to work with the server wherever it is.
